In terms of packaging efficiency, pre-made pouch filling machines are generally significantly superior to traditional manual packaging, though differences exist in flexibility and initial costs. Below is a detailed comparative analysis.
Pre-made Pouch Packaging Machine
Efficiency Comparison
Speed: High degree of automation, capable of 30–120 packs per minute (depending on model), suitable for high-volume production of standardized products (e.g., food, daily chemicals).
Continuity: Can operate 24/7 with minimal manual intervention (e.g., material refill, troubleshooting).
Example: For packaging small snack bags, a pouch machine can be 5–10 times more efficient than manual labor.
Core Advantages Comparison
| Dimension | Pre-made Pouch Filling Machine | Manual Packaging |
|---|---|---|
| Speed | Extremely fast, ideal for high-volume production | Slow, suitable for low-volume production |
| Consistency | High precision, reduced errors | Relies on worker skill, prone to variation |
| Labor Cost | Long-term savings (1 machine ≈ 5–10 workers) | Low short-term cost, but high long-term labor burden |
| Flexibility | Requires mold change for different products | Easily adjustable, adapts to changing needs |
| Initial Investment | High (equipment maintenance) | Low (tools labor) |
Application Scenario Suggestions
Prioritize Pre-made Pouch Filling Machine when:
Products are standardized (e.g., prepared meals, granules/powders).
Order volume is large and stable (e.g., over 10 million packs/year).
High hygiene requirements (e.g., pharmaceuticals, food).
Prioritize Manual Packaging when:
Product types change frequently (e.g., customized gifts).
Budget is limited or output is very low (<10,000 packs/day).
Packaging is complex (e.g., multi-step assembly).
Industry Data Reference
Efficiency improvement: After introducing pre-made pouch machines, packaging efficiency increases by an average of 300%–500% (Source: Packaging Digest).
Payback period: Typically 1–2 years through labor cost savings (based on an average daily output of 100,000 packs).
Conclusion
Pre-made pouch filling machines are the clear winner in efficiency, especially suitable for mass production. Traditional manual packaging still holds value in flexibility and small-batch scenarios. Enterprises should choose based on product characteristics, output volume, and long-term planning, or adopt a hybrid model (e.g., pouch machine for main production manual packaging for special orders).
